Director Roman Polanski arrested
By nytimes.com
Published: 09/28/2009

Director Roman Polanski's three decades as a fugitive from U.S. rape charges finally ended Sunday when he was arrested upon landing in Switzerland to accept a lifetime achievement award.

The 76-year-old director of "Chinatown," "Rosemary's Baby" and "The Pianist," whose pregnant wife Sharon Tate was butchered in their home by Charles Manson's cult followers in 1969, was one of the world's most famous fugitives.

He was arrested without incident at the Zurich airport and was being held for extradition to California, police said.

The Los Angeles County district attorney's office said prosecutors drew up a warrant learning last week that Polanski planned to show up at the Zurich Film Festival, where he would not be protected from arrest.

Polanski fled to Europe in 1978 after he was convicted in California of raping a 13-year-old girl he had lured to the Hollywood Hills home of actor Jack Nicholson for a photo shoot.
